Map Projections Explained

The Gall Peters projection offers an equal area perspective, showcasing Africa's true size compared to Greenland, but sacrifices shape in the process. Various projections, like the Winkel Triple and Robinson, strive to balance size and shape, providing better representations of the world. While the Mercator projection is excellent for navigation, it distorts the globe when viewed as a whole, highlighting the importance of choosing the right map for different purposes.
